How much do oracle bi publisher jobs pay per hour?

As of May 31, 2026, the average hourly pay for oracle bi publisher in the United States is $29.90,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$23.08 and $34.38 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an Oracle BI Publisher job?

An Oracle BI Publisher job involves designing, developing, and managing reports using Oracle BI Publisher, a tool for generating and distributing business reports. Professionals in this role work with data sources, create templates, and optimize report performance. They often collaborate with business analysts and database administrators to ensure accurate and efficient reporting. Skills in SQL, XML, and integration with Oracle applications are typically required.

What are some common projects or responsibilities for an Oracle BI Publisher within a typical organization?

Oracle BI Publishers are usually tasked with designing, developing, and maintaining reports and dashboards that enable data-driven decisions across departments. They regularly collaborate with business analysts, IT teams, and end-users to gather report requirements, ensure data accuracy, and troubleshoot issues. Typical daily tasks may include building data models, writing SQL queries, formatting reports, and integrating output with other Oracle applications. This role offers exposure to various business functions and can lead to advancement into broader business intelligence or data analytics positions.

Job description

Job Description
We are the leading provider of worldwide smart end-to-end supply chain & logistics, enabling the flow of trade across the globe. Our comprehensive range of products and services covers every link of the integrated supply chain - from maritime and inland terminals to marine services and industrial parks as well as technology-driven customer solutions.
The Technical Analyst is responsible for overseeing the design, development, and management of reporting solutions within the Oracle Fusion environment. This role involves collaborating with business stakeholders, technical teams, and end-users to create, customize, and maintain reports that provide valuable insights into business performance and data analysis. The Technical Analyst shall ensure efficient delivery of accurate and actionable information through well-designed reports and dashboards.
Location: 1415 Vantage Park Dr.; Charlotte, NC 28203
K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ES
  • Responsible for overseeing the design, development, and management of reporting solutions within the Oracle Fusion environment
  • Collaborate with business stakeholders, technical teams, and end-users to create, customize, and maintain reports that provide valuable insights into business performance and data analysis
  • Ensure efficient delivery of accurate and actionable information through well-designed reports and dashboards
  • Collaborate with business units to understand reporting requirements, data needs, and key performance indicators; develop a comprehensive reporting strategy that aligns with organizational goals and objectives
  • Lead the design and development of various types of reports, including operational, analytical, and ad-hoc reports, using Oracle BI Publisher, Oracle Reports, and related tools; collaborate with data analysts and business analysts to ensure accurate data extraction, transformation, and presentation
  • Collaborate with business units to understand reporting needs, objectives, and key performance indicators
  • Translate business requirements into technical specifications for report development; design and develop various types of reports, including operational, analytical, and ad-hoc reports, using Oracle BI Publisher, Oracle Reports, and relevant tools; create data visualizations and dashboards to present insights effectively
  • utilize Oracle Cloud analytics, reporting solutions, data warehousing, project management, BI Publisher, PL/SQL, Jira, Service Now, and Rally to perform duties; extract and transform data from various sources, ensuring data accuracy and consistency
  • Use SQL queries and scripting languages to manipulate and prepare data for reporting; support a team of report developers and analysts, data migration analysts, providing technical guidance and support; help define best practices for report development, data visualization, and user experience
  • Design and develop interactive dashboards and data visualizations using BI Analytics or other relevant tools
  • Ensure dashboards provide actionable insights and enable effective decision-making; collaborate with integration teams to ensure data connectivity from various sources into reporting solutions
  • Establish data connections, data models, and data hierarchies to support reporting needs
  • Establish testing strategies and methodologies to ensure the accuracy and reliability of reports and dashboards
  • Perform thorough testing, including data validation and usability testing; provide assistance to end-users on report usage, navigation, and interpretation
  • Offer technical support and assistance to users encountering issues with reports
  • Create and maintain documentation for report specifications, data mappings, and technical documentation; telecommuting 1 day per week permitted

QUALIFICATIONS, EXPERIENCE, & SKILLS
  • Bachelor's Degree in Computer Engineering,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, Electronic Engineering, or in a related field of study (will accept equivalent foreign degree)
  • Two (2) years in the position above, as an Analytics Technical Consultant, as a Cloud Consultant, as a Data Engineer, as a Software Engineer, or in a related occupation
  • Experience must include two (2) years' use of all the following: Oracle Cloud analytics, reporting solutions, data warehousing, project management, BI Publisher, PL/SQL, Jira, Service Now, and Rally
  • Will also accept any suitable combination of education, training, and/or experience.
  • Telecommuting 1 day per week permitted
